Salon Republic Lynnwood on 33rd
Beauty Salons
Salon Republic Lynnwood on 33rd is a beauty salons based in Washington, WA. Contact them at +14256162070.
beauty-salonhair
Beauty Salons
Salon Republic Lynnwood on 33rd is a beauty salons based in Washington, WA. Contact them at +14256162070.